Finding parking near Suarlée, Namur
Looking for parking Suarlée (5020 Namur)? Start by checking the street signs where you plan to park: in Suarlée there aren’t clearly marked dedicated paid/blue-zone streets everywhere, but parking is still enforced and rules can change from one road to the next.
Street parking in Suarlée: rely on what the signs say
Many Suarlée streets function like “normal” on-street parking (no specific blue-disc or pay-and-display zone indicated). Still, you must park legally and safely—don’t block driveways, keep clear of hazards, and follow any local markings (lines, time-limit signs, or restrictions on certain kerbs).
If you see a blue zone or time-limited signs, use them correctly
Some streets in Namur can be regulated (for example with a blue parking disc or limited-duration rules). In practice, the best approach is simple: if there’s a regulation sign, follow that exact rule for that spot (disc/payment/time limit). When there’s no such signage, the general road rules apply.
Public parking options nearby if Suarlée streets are full
If you can’t find an easy space close to where you’re going, consider moving to larger public car parks in Namur—especially around the university and central areas. Local guidance for Namur commonly mentions pay parking around St-Aubain / Palais de Justice, and paid options linked to the main city zones (rather than relying only on residential street spaces).
Visitor parking at business parks in Suarlée (where allowed)
Suarlée has business areas that provide parking for occupants and visitors. For example, Business Village Ecolys (Actibel) lists a large parking capacity (800 places) for people connected to the site—access rules can still depend on entry signage and permitted visitor flows.
Event days: expect temporary no-parking areas
During certain event periods, temporary restrictions can be set (including no parking along the Nationale 4 and in specific streets/parking areas in Suarlée). If your trip falls on an event day, look up the latest mobility notices before you arrive and be ready to use the designated public areas and routes provided for shuttles/visitors. Quick checklist before you park
- Take 10 seconds to read the exact road sign for that parking bay (disc/time/payment/permits).
- Bring the right setup (parking disc if the sign requires it, and payment method if it’s pay-and-display).
- Avoid curb-side bays that look “close to traffic” or restricted by markings (lines/colour/extra signs).
- On event days, assume normal street rules may be overridden by temporary restrictions.
